Understanding Lateral Ankle Sprains
The lateral aspect of the ankle is primarily supported by the anterior talofibular ligament (ATFL), the calcaneofibular ligament (CFL), and the posterior talofibular ligament (PTFL). Among these, the ATFL is the most frequently injured ligament during a lateral ankle sprain. This injury typically occurs when the foot is planted and the ankle suddenly inverts, placing immense stress on these fibrous tissues. The severity of the sprain is categorized into three grades, ranging from mild stretching to complete ligament tears, which directly influences the recovery timeline and rehabilitation strategy.
What is Kinesiology Tape?
Kinesiology tape is an elastic therapeutic tape designed to mimic the elasticity of human skin. Unlike traditional athletic tape, kt tape ankle sprain lateral application allows for a full range of motion while providing gentle sensory feedback to the nervous system. The tape is applied in specific patterns to lift the skin slightly, creating space between the dermis and underlying tissues. This purported mechanism is believed to reduce pressure on pain receptors, decrease inflammation, and enhance proprioception—the body’s ability to sense joint position and movement.
Mechanism of Action
When applied correctly, kt tape for a lateral ankle sprain works through several physiological pathways. The gentle lifting of the skin may help reduce swelling by facilitating lymphatic drainage. Additionally, the tape provides a physical reminder to the wearer about proper joint alignment, discouraging excessive inversion. The sensory input from the tape may also help modulate pain signals, allowing individuals to move more confidently during the rehabilitation phase without compromising stability.
Application Techniques for Lateral Ankle Sprains
Applying kinesiology tape for an ankle sprain requires precision to ensure optimal support. The skin must be clean and dry, and hair removal in the application area is often recommended for better adhesion. For a lateral ankle sprain, practitioners typically use an "I-strip" or "Y-strip" configuration starting near the base of the fifth metatarsal and extending toward the medial malleolus. The tape is applied with varying degrees of tension—usually 25% stretch—to provide support without restricting circulation.
Ensure the ankle is in a neutral or slightly dorsiflexed position during application.
Use pre-taping skin preparation to enhance adhesion and longevity.
Anchor strips are applied first to create a stable base.
Fan or "Y" strips are often used to cover the lateral ligament area.
Rub the tape firmly after application to activate the adhesive and improve bonding.
Benefits and Limitations
The primary benefit of using kt tape ankle sprain lateral support is the potential for early mobilization. By providing external support, individuals may experience reduced pain and improved confidence during weight-bearing activities. This can be particularly valuable in the early stages of rehabilitation when transitioning from rest to movement. However, it is crucial to understand that kinesiology tape is a complementary tool, not a cure. It does not repair torn ligaments but rather supports the healing process by encouraging proper biomechanics.
